Waterproof Jacket for Walking

Outdoor activities can be affected by diverse factors some of which involve the elements of weather. When it comes to rains and precipitation, you will always need something to protect you. Waterproof jackets should always be part of your gear when going for a walk or cycling. Out there, you are not sure of the type of weather that you will meet. It might be chilly or even freezing especially during the winters. To ensure that you are fully protected from these elements, a waterproof walking jacket will save you a great deal.

For cold and wet weather, you will need a jacket that retains your body temperatures while at the same time keeping you dry. This factor will largely depend on the materials making the jacket. Since the main aim of buying this kind of jacket is for protection against elements of weather, you will need to go for the one that is made from the best materials for maximum protection. Fit

The best clothing of any kind is the one that fits you well. A waterproof jacket is not an exception. You should make sure that it has a good zip that does not stop midway but zips up to the chin. Moreover, the best waterproof walking is the one that has cuffs that have been fastened. If the fastening goes up to the wrist the better. This will ensure that water does not get its way through the inside of the jacket to the body. It is also essential to ensure that the kind of jacket that you go for has its waist drawcords in the right position. This ensures that the long jackets are easy to adjust as fast as possible hence ensuring maximum protection. This property is mostly relevant when the involved jacket is longer and goes way down to the knees or even further. However, you should ensure that you do not go for a jacket that can restrict your movement due to its length. Too long jackets that are zipped from the bottom hinder comfortable pacing. At the same time, the jacket should not be too short such that as you move it exposes your back. Such a jacket should be avoided because it might not serve its purpose as required. Nonetheless, make sure that the jacket you purchase fits the underneath base layer and the mid layer in the best way.

Hood

When the rest of the body is covered most of the times, the head will tend to be the avenue to heat loss. Therefore, going for a hooded walking jacket is a good idea. However, you must ensure that the hood is easy to adjust. It should fit in the head and be easily adjustable such that it moves together with the head. Make sure that your view does not get restricted by the hood. When the weather is very bad, go for the jacket with a stiffened hood. The hood should also be helmet compatible to avoid complications in times when you have to take a ride back home.

Zips

Most of the times, people do not consider the nature of zips when they go about purchasing attires. During cold and bad weathers’ a jacket that is not easy to fasten is very frustrating. The zips should always be waterproof to prevent the water from slipping into the inside of the jacket. When a jacket is waterproof, all the other parts must be waterproof to avoid frustrations. However, in some cases, the zip might not be waterproof. In such cases, you should make sure that the zip is covered in straps that prevent water from penetrating into the jacket. Zips are also important to open up the jacket when the body gets too hot.

Pockets

When you are walking, you might need to carry something around. The number of pockets in your jacket depends on how you intend to use it for. If you will have to use a compass or even an OS map, you will need the kind of a jacket that has large chest pockets or inside pockets. Make sure that the pockets have flaps covering the zips to prevent water from penetrating to the inside.
